The Reading Life With John Magill And David Cuthbert With Bob Bruce

This week on The Reading Life: Susan talks with John Magill about this new book, "The Incomparable Magazine Street." David Cuthbert and Bob Bruce, who’ve adapted their musical show, "Cinderella Battistella," into a children’s fairy tale Nawlins style, whoop it up. And Susan has a review of Jesmyn Ward's magnificent National Book Award finalist, "Sing, Unburied, Sing."

The Reading Life in 2010, Susan Larson was the book editor for The New Orleans Times-Picayune from 1988-2009. She has served on the boards of the Tennessee Williams/New Orleans Literary Festival and the New Orleans Public Library. She is the founder of the New Orleans chapter of the Women's National Book Association, which presents the annual Diana Pinckley Prizes for Crime Fiction.. In 2007, she received the Louisiana Endowment for the Humanities lifetime achievement award for her contributions to the literary community. She is also the author of The Booklover's Guide to New Orleans. If you run into her in a local bookstore or library, she'll be happy to suggest something you should read. She thinks New Orleans is the best literary town in the world, and she reads about a book a day.
